import re
regex = re.compile(r"^hsla?\((?:(-?\d+(?:deg|g?rad|turn)?),\s*((?:\d{1,2}|100)%),\s*((?:\d{1,2}|100)%)(?:,\s*((?:\d{1,2}|100)%|0(?:\.\d+)?|1))?|(-?\d+(?:deg|g?rad|turn)?)\s+((?:\d{1,2}|100)%)\s+((?:\d{1,2}|100)%)(?:\s+((?:\d{1,2}|100)%|0(?:\.\d+)?|1))?)\)$", flags=re.MULTILINE | re.IGNORECASE)
test_str = ("hsl(123deg, 100%, 0%)\n"
"hsl(123, 100%, 0%)\n"
"hsl(123rad 100% 0%)\n"
"hsla(123grad, 100%, 0%, 0)\n"
"hsla(-123turn 100% 0% 1)\n"
"hsla(1 100% 0% 50%)\n\n"
"bad ones\n"
" hsl(123deg, 100%, 0%)\n"
"hsl(123, 100%, 0%) \n"
"hsl(123ad 100% 0%)\n"
"hsla(123grd, 100%, 0%, 0)\n"
"hsla(-123trn 100% 0% 1)\n"
"hsla(1 a% 0% 50%)\n")
matches = regex.finditer(test_str)
for match_num, match in enumerate(matches, start=1):
print(f"Match {match_num} was found at {match.start()}-{match.end()}: {match.group()}")
for group_num, group in enumerate(match.groups(), start=1):
print(f"Group {group_num} found at {match.start(group_num)}-{match.end(group_num)}: {group}")
